Визуализация пользовательского представления в SuiteCRM не работает - PullRequest
0 голосов
/ 19 ноября 2018

У меня есть контроллер, который вызывает мой пользовательский вид, но пользовательский вид не обрабатывается. Я не могу понять проблему, все выглядит правильно для меня. Также не отображаются какие-либо ошибки или предупреждения.

Мой модуль называется SCRV_SSRS_CRM_Reports_View

У меня есть код ниже:

пользовательские / модули / SCRV_SSRS_CRM_Reports_View / controller.php

require_once('include/MVC/Controller/SugarController.php');

class SCRV_SSRS_CRM_Reports_ViewController extends SugarController
{
    function action_test(){
        $GLOBALS['log']->fatal('Am in Controller');
        $this->view = "test";
    }
}

А в

пользовательские / модули / SCRV_SSRS_CRM_Reports_View / просмотров / view.test.php

if (!defined('sugarEntry') || !sugarEntry) die('Not A Valid Entry Point');

require_once('include/MVC/View/views/view.list.php');

class SCRV_SSRS_CRM_Reports_ViewViewtest extends ViewList
{

    public function display()
    {
        echo "HIIII";
        $GLOBALS['log']->fatal('Am in View');
    }
}

Не могу увидеть, как представление отображается, когда я получаю к нему доступ

http://localhost:8080/dev-crm/index.php?module=SCRV_SSRS_CRM_Reports_View&action=test

Я не вижу HIIII, отображаемый на экране или в записи журнала.

...